The Tashkent city administration has assured that the renowned flea market 'Yangiabad' will not be transformed into a typical modern shopping complex. During the renovation, its specialization, recognizable atmosphere, and the spots of current vendors will be preserved.
The plans include creating necessary sanitary conditions, enhancing security levels, and arranging convenient walkways and parking areas. The project also envisions infrastructure development and overall improvement of the market area.
Currently, city officials together with designers are working on a renovation concept for 'Yangiabad'. It is intended to be submitted for public discussion, allowing residents, visitors, and sellers to review the proposals and voice their opinions.
The timeline for the start and completion of the works has not been announced yet. Earlier, it was reported that the 'Kadysheva' market in Tashkent would be improved, with landscaping and parking lot upgrades.
